Sodium carbonate (Na2CO3) is an inorganic compound classified as a salt. It is composed of sodium cations (Na+) and carbonate anions (CO3^2-).

H2SO4 + Na2CO3 = Na2SO4 + H2O + CO2 This is an acid/carbonate reaction. The general equations for acid reactions are;- Acid + alkali =- salt + water Acid + base = salt + weater Acid + metal = salt + hydrogen Acid + carbonate = salt + water + carbon dioxide.
